Overview

Install a Humminbird LakeMaster® Map Card to add enhanced or high definition lake maps to your Humminbird chartplotter. The Humminbird LakeMaster PLUS Map Card allows you to add an aerial image base layer to your LakeMaster map.

Compatibility:

Humminbird LakeMaster Map Cards are compatible with HELIX® control heads with chartplotting capabilities and all SOLIX® control heads. Visit humminbird.com for the latest compatibility information.

LakeMaster PLUS Compatibility:

Your HELIX chartplotter must have software version 7.460 or later to display LakeMaster PLUS maps. All SOLIX control head software is compatible with LakeMaster Plus.

Set up the Control Head

Use these instructions to start using LakeMaster features with your Humminbird control head.

1 | Update the Control Head Software (HELIX models only)

Ensure your HELIX control head has the latest software version installed. LakeMaster PLUS requires software version 7.460 or later.

Check the Current Software Version:

  1. Power On: Press the POWER key.
  2. When the title screen is displayed, press the MENU key.
  3. Select System Status from the Start-Up Options menu. Read the Software Version number.
  4. Power Off: Press and hold the POWER key.

Diagram shows a typical software version display screen with the text "software version" followed by a version number.

Update the Control Head Software:

? NOTE: It is important to back up your control head's data files periodically before updating software.

  1. Insert a formatted microSD or SD card into your PC. Use a card adapter if necessary.
  2. Download: Visit humminbird.com, navigate to Support > Software Updates. Select the file name for your control head model. Follow on-screen prompts to save the software file to the microSD or SD card.
  3. Insert the microSD or SD card with the updated software file into the control head slot.
  4. Power On: The control head will recognize the new software and guide you through the installation prompts.

3 | Adjust the Water Level Offset

It is important to note if the water level is higher or lower than normal for accurate map display. Set the Water Level Offset accordingly.

Diagrams show the Water Level Offset setting on HELIX, illustrating a setting of 0 (Off) and an adjusted setting of -4.

If the water is lower than normal, a negative offset extends the land visually on the map. If the water is higher than normal, a positive offset extends the water line visually on the map.

Tips for Using the Map

Move Across the Chart:

Use the Joystick (SOLIX) or the 4-WAY Cursor Control keys (HELIX) to move the cursor across the chart.

See More on the Chart:

Zoom in (+) and zoom out (-) to view more detail, such as contour lines and depth colors.

View Map Information:

Move the cursor to an icon, contour line, or position on the chart and press the CHECK/INFO key. On SOLIX, if the cursor is not snapped to an object, press CHECK/INFO a second time or select Map Info from the Info Menu.

Change the Chart Orientation:

Select your display preference:

SOLIX: From the Chart X-Press Menu, select Chart Options, then General, then Orientation. Select an orientation.

HELIX: Press MENU twice, select the Chart tab, select Chart Orientation, then select an orientation.

Highlight a Depth Range

Depth Highlight allows you to identify a specific depth range in Chart views. The selected range is highlighted in green.

SOLIX Steps: In Humminbird Settings, select Depth Highlight. Tap on/off or press ENTER to show/hide. Adjust the setting using the slider. Select Highlight Range (+/-) and adjust the slider.

HELIX Steps: In the HB Chart tab, select Highlight 1. Press CHECK/INFO or RIGHT Cursor key to show/hide. Set Highlight 1 Min or Highlight 1 Max using RIGHT/LEFT Cursor keys.

Highlight a Shallow Water Range

When the depth is equal to or less than the set amount, it will be highlighted in red. For example, setting Shallow Water Highlight to 3 feet shows a red band from 0-3 feet, useful for boats with a 3-foot draft.

Change the Base Layer for the Chart Combo View (SOLIX models only)

In Chart/Chart Combo View, you can display a different Base Layer in each window. This requires setting the User Mode to Custom.

Change the User Mode:

? NOTE: Export your menu settings before changing to Custom mode.

  1. Press HOME, then tap Settings (or use Joystick and ENTER).
  2. Select General.
  3. Under User Mode, select Angler (recommended) or Custom.

Change Base Layer in Chart Combo Views:

  1. With the Chart/Chart Combo View displayed, select a pane.
  2. Tap Chart in the status bar or press MENU once.
  3. Select Chart Options.
  4. Select Global (below Humminbird Settings).
  5. Tap the on/off button or press ENTER to turn Global off.
  6. Select Humminbird Settings > Base Layer.
  7. Tap or use the Joystick and ENTER key to select a base layer.

Follow the Contour

Follow the Contour allows you to navigate a specific depth contour using i-Pilot® Link (separate purchase required). You can select a contour line and follow it in either direction, or use Contour Offset to maintain a set distance from a contour line or shoreline.

Required: i-Pilot Link with a ZeroLine Map Card or i-Pilot Compatible LakeMaster Map Card. Visit humminbird.com for i-Pilot Link purchase information.

⚠️ WARNING! See your i-Pilot Link manual for warnings, safety information, and operations instructions. You are responsible for the safe and prudent operation of your boat. Always maintain a watch and be prepared to regain manual control.

1 | Preparation

Before using Follow the Contour, ensure contour lines are displayed and the Water Level Offset is set correctly.

Adjust the Water Level Offset:

Set the Water Level Offset based on current lake levels (refer to "Set up for the Day" section for detailed instructions).

Set Contour Lines to Visible:

Ensure contour lines are enabled in the map settings (refer to "Adjust the Map Display Settings" section for detailed instructions).

Set the Contour Offset

You can set a Contour Offset to maintain a set distance from a contour line or shoreline. This is a distance setting only and does not measure water depth. Enter the offset based on your knowledge of the area.

? NOTE: Contour Offset does NOT account for changes in water depth. Be aware of depth variations and adjust the offset as needed.

Your boat must be positioned within 1/4 mile of the selected contour to set the offset.

Adjust the Contour Offset during Navigation

SOLIX: Tap Chart, select Go To > Contour Offset, and adjust the slider.

HELIX: Press GOTO, select Contour Offset, and use RIGHT/LEFT Cursor keys to adjust.

Reverse Direction

SOLIX: Tap Chart, select Go To > Reverse.

HELIX: Press GOTO, select Reverse Direction, press RIGHT Cursor key.

Cancel i-Pilot Navigation

SOLIX: Tap Chart, select Go To > Cancel Navigation.

HELIX: Press GOTO, select Cancel Navigation, press RIGHT Cursor key, and follow prompts.
